Tame Flyaways For Polish
To keep a sleek high pony clean from stray flyaways, I start with a quick pre-slick: mist the roots with a lightweight setting spray, then brush through with a soft, narrow comb to smooth every strand into place.
Next, I seal edges with a tiny amount of clear gel, blow-dry on low heat, and finish with a shine spray for lasting polish and lengthened silhouette. Incorporating elements from ponytail wedding hairstyles can elevate your bridal look even further.

Wrapped Ponytail Tips
Wrapped ponytails with metallic accents are a quick elevate—I love how a slim chain or shimmering beads trace the wrap, creating a radiant line that catches light from every angle.
For polish, I keep the wrap snug, secure with discreet pins, and balance shine with a smooth, tailored tail.
Tip: choose metallics that compliment your jewelry for harmony.
